Output ed66f0fc06203a4ca67c322a0b7b5d042a23e422d66ad0e0ebac76833de4c20b:0
- value
- 3162551
- script pubkey
- OP_0 OP_PUSHBYTES_20 50b8646247ab5b41f4cb725579861feb4044007b
- address
- bc1q2zuxgcj84dd5raxtwf2hnpsladqygqrmv7dnj7
- transaction
- ed66f0fc06203a4ca67c322a0b7b5d042a23e422d66ad0e0ebac76833de4c20b
- confirmations
- 29788
- spent
- true